Check alle échte Black Friday-deals Ook zo moe van nepaanbiedingen? Wij laten alleen échte deals zien

[MS Excel 2007] 2 verschillende datum layouts matchen

Pagina: 1
Acties:

  • Terror
  • Registratie: Juni 1999
  • Laatst online: 11:07
Ik heb 2 sheets. Sheet 1 gaat als volgt om met de data:

code:
1
2
3
4
5
6
7
8
9
Kolom A    Kolom B
jan-1991   Waarde
feb-1991   Waarde
mar-1991    Waarde
....
dec-1991    Waarde
jan-1992     Waarde
etc
jan-2009     Waarde


Nu heb ik een tweede sheet in welke de data als volgt geordend staan
code:
1
2
3
4
5
6
Kolom A    Kolom B ...... Kolom X
Yaar        Jan    ......   dec
1991       waarde  ...... waarde
1992       waarde  ...... waarde
.....      .....   ......  .....
2009       waarde  ...... waarde



Nu wil ik de waarden in sheet 1 met de corresponderende waarden in sheet 2 vermenigvuldigen.

Ik heb al gekeken naar lookup functies, maar feit dat jaren en maanden in sheet 1 gekoppeld zijn en in sheet 2 niet, gooit hier roet in het eten. Ik heb overwogen om van sheet 2 een matrix te maken en hier elke keer een rij getransponeerd te vermenigvuldigen met een jaargang. Maar dit is redelijk arbeids intensief.
Aangezien ik dit grapje nog 30 keer op andere data mag uitvoeren vroeg ik me af of het ook makkelijker (automagisch) kan?

ps: Ik heb nu een matchend voorbeeld gemaakt, maar sommige sheets bevatten data de terug gaat tot eind 1890 terwijl de corresponderende sheet pas bij 1950 begint. Dus iets wat zoekt zou ideaal zijn, omdat er geen leeg ruimte ontstaan.

pps: Ik heb geen ervaring met VBA

Dell XPS M1530 (Red) | T8300 | 4 GB | 750 GB 7200 rpm | 8600m GT | Wifi N | 1440x900 LG | 9 Cells | Windows 8.1 Pro x64


  • pedorus
  • Registratie: Januari 2008
  • Niet online
Dit kan denk ik het snelst met een pivottable (kruistabel). Je kunt dan de datums groeperen op jaar en maand, en van de gegevens het gemiddelde nemen.

Vitamine D tekorten in Nederland | Dodelijk coronaforum gesloten